SASKATOON – A man and woman have been arrested in Saskatoon after a sawed-off 12-gauge shotgun was found in a vehicle Saturday morning. Saskatoon police say they received a tip that a couple in a purple truck were in possession of an illegal firearm.
Just before 8 a.m., officers responded to the 600-block of Avenue O North and found a vehicle matching the description leaving the area. The truck was eventually stopped in the 1600-block of 33rd Street West.
Both occupants were arrested and the firearm was seized.

The 20-year-old man is now facing numerous firearm-related charges. The 22-year-old woman was wanted on a number of outstanding warrants and was also in possession of a small amount of illegal narcotics.
Police say additional charges may be laid as the investigation is ongoing.
